Alexander Firanchuk and Gasan Ramazanov on prospects of oil production in the USA

Nezavisimaya Gazeta published the opinion of the Gaidar Institute experts Alexander Firanchuk and Gasan Ramazanov on how Trump’s plans to increase oil production may affect the global oil market.

Alexander Firanchuk believes that US companies are unlikely to increase production in response to lower prices. «Oil production in the US on the average becomes profitable at a significant part of fields at a price of about $70 per barrel. The risk is elsewhere: if Trump initiates a real global trade war, it will inevitably result in a cooling of global economy and, therefore, a reduction in demand for oil," he believes.

Gasan Ramazanov added that Trump’s fulfillment of the plan to increase oil production in the US may affect global oil prices, which will decline, as production and supply of US oil to the world market intensifies. The expert also noted that very low oil prices will also bring harm to the US oil industry, as the US is one of the largest exporters of oil to the world market.
